Dear All,

I have altered the approach, and changed the FW of my UFS922 from Kathrein to TitanNIT v1.62.

What is working now:
1.
I have installed a Samba Server on the UFS922, so all media files can be streamed to any Kodi device.
Although I'm using advancedsettings.xml for the .trp files, I do not get the desired results for those.
This seems to be due to the directory structure Kathrein imposes on me:
<Videoname> <~aufnahme> aufnahme00.trp

If I move aufnahme00.trp into <Videoname> like
<Videoname> aufnahme00.trp

then Kodi can access the trp file and play it back. Is there a way to configure Kodi for this strange directory structure?


2.
Livestreaming now works even with EPG support, as TitanNIT supports an Enigma2 API converter so I'm using now the Enigma2 PVR addon for Kodi.

3.
Recording needs further investigation. I get error messages when I try to schedule a recording through Kodi, but now and then it seems to work. Will keep you posted on that.

Well, actually running TitanNit on the UFS922 gives me the streaming on Kodi for recorded and live TV.
I do also run Kodi on the Amazon Fire TV box.

More details:
- run TitanNIT on your UFS922
- install E2WebIfAPI as extension on TitanNIT
- use the Enigma PVR in Kodi
- play back live TV in Kodi
- install xupnp as extension on TitanNIT
- play back recorded TV in Kodi
- add the upnp UFS922 resource in Kodi
- add Kodi to FireTV: http://kodi.wiki/view/Amazon_Fire_TV
